Hand-churned small-batch since 1997 in Port Moody, with banana fudge, espresso flake, and a doggie scoop for the third wheel.
Rocky Point Ice Cream has been the unofficial conclusion to every Port Moody afternoon since 1997, and if you've ever stood in a line that snakes past a dog who also has plans here, you understand the loyalty. Everything is hand-churned from local, organic ingredients, which is the kind of detail that sounds like marketing until you taste the banana fudge. The espresso flake is equally argued-over. Order two flavours you've never shared before, split a cone, and stroll the inlet while racing the melt. The dog is welcome too, and yes, there's a doggie scoop so they don't just watch you eat. Plant-based options exist for the person on the date who made that decision. The whole outing costs less than a movie ticket, and unlike a movie, no one shushes you for talking.
